CITC 2390 - CIT Capstone |
The CIT Capstone course is designed to give students real-world projects that require them to use all the skills that they have developed as a computer and information science major. The course will require students to complete a major group project based on real-world case studies..
Prerequisites & Notes
Note: This course was formerly CISP 2980.
Prerequisites: Department Approval.
3 Credit Hours - 1 Lecture Hour - 4 Lab Hours (F, S)
Note: Course not designed for transfer.
